Newly sided “Rustic Board on Board” siding. John Scheafnocker of Timber Trails came with his portable Wood Mizer band mill and cut 2,000 board feet of Red Pine from our neighbor’s property. We are very fortunate that all the maples are arranged on a hillside, which made the tubing runs very easy. Newly sided “Rustic Board on Board” siding.
